Output 31f1170788af13f9a6191133b130097a4259959e1edca8566b01aa6842d25c44:0

value
11685712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d643f80264d25b3b200fc7e797c9d2ed4da79a45 OP_EQUAL
address
3MDwx9dKNsVPjLGzt5Azf4LscFezZckoHx
transaction
31f1170788af13f9a6191133b130097a4259959e1edca8566b01aa6842d25c44
spent
true